To understand the current engine market, one must look at the recent history that reshaped developer sentiment. The controversy surrounding Unity’s 2023 runtime fee and the subsequent “Great Migration” led to a massive influx of talent into open-source alternatives like Godot. Meanwhile, Epic Games solidified its dominance in the AAA space, positioning Unreal Engine 5 as the “center of gravity” for high-fidelity production.
Today, studios are more “engine-literate” than ever, often maintaining hybrid pipelines to mitigate risk.
Unreal Engine 5.x has moved past its experimental phase to become a mature production powerhouse. For any studio targeting photorealism on PC, PS5 Pro, or next-gen consoles, Unreal is the default choice.
After a period of turbulence, Unity 6 (the current LTS standard) represents a return to “stability as a feature.” It remains the undisputed king of mobile, VR/AR, and multi-platform deployment.
Godot has successfully transitioned from a hobbyist tool to a professional-grade engine. In 2026, it is the primary “safe harbor” for developers seeking 100% royalty-free autonomy.
Beyond the “Big Three,” the 2026 market offers powerful specialized tools that often outperform the giants in specific niches:
The successor to Amazon Lumberyard, O3DE is an open-source, modular engine backed by the Linux Foundation. It is particularly popular for enterprise-grade simulations and cloud-integrated games that require AWS-native synergy.
If your project is purely 2D, GameMaker remains the fastest path to market. Its specialized 2D toolset and efficient GML scripting language have powered hits from Undertale to the latest indie platformers.
Dominant in the Asian market, Cocos Creator is the premier choice for high-performance mobile and web-based mini-games. It offers a lightweight 3D framework that runs natively in browsers and mobile apps with almost zero overhead.
For browser-based gaming and hyper-casual titles, Construct 3 offers the industry’s most robust no-code workflow. Meanwhile, Phaser 4 remains the benchmark for developers who prefer a code-first, JavaScript/TypeScript-native environment.
